- mpnB005T7H4Z8
- brandname: Omron
- manufacturername: Omron
Omron Electronic Components Microswitch, Roller Lever, Spdt 3A 250V - D2SW-3L2MS


- Brand: Omron
- PartNumber: D2SW-3L2MS
- PackageQuantity: 1
- Manufacturer: Omron Electronic Components
- Label: Omron Electronic Components